Casper Elgaard returns for the finale
FDM Motorsport driver, Casper Elgaard, has now confirmed that he will join his teammate Jens Møller for the final Danish Touring Car Championship race of the season. After having been forced to stand out the latest race at Ring Djursland, he as now secured funding for the last race at FDM Jyllandsringen.
In the mean time he has been busy dancing in the Danish edition of “Strictly Come Dancing”. But racing is after all his main business.
The grey Seat Leon TFSI will once again, drive after having parked at Ring Djursland, and also vacant after the crash at FDM Jyllandsringen the 13. of September.
“It will be great,“ Elgaard explains. “It is not that I dislike dancing, but I have been looking forward to get back in the drivers seat.”
“This year it has been a particular tough year, where I haven’t been driving as much as before, but it has been a tough year to find sponsors. And when you don’t have them, you are not driving. I am looking forward to get back into the car, especially after the last race where I claimed pole and won a heat.”
Team mate Jens Møller is in with a fighting chance in the Independents Cup, where he is tailing Honda driver Per Poulsen in the championship with 22 points. Elgaard is promising the privateer all the help he can get.
“Actually we have two goals. Jens´ chances in the Independents Cup are by far the most important, but we would also like to win the finale and end the season on a high. This would be the first finale victory, and it would be very helpful before the upcoming season. It would be great with a boost, but Jens´ championship chances are our first priority.“
